Grant County health officials confirm H1N1 flu death
Posted: Nov 09, 2009 12:52 PM EST
LANCASTER (WKOW) -- The Grant County Health Department has confirmed the first H1N1 influenza related death in that county.
According to a news release posted last Friday, Director/Health Officer Jeff Kindrai said, "The loss of a loved one for anyone is heartbreaking. Our thoughts are with the family and friends during this difficult time."
The deceased is described as an adult with underlying health conditions. Citing respect for the family and patient confidentiality laws, health officials declined to release the individual?s sex, age, race or location of residence.
